All the Latest Game Footage and Images from Return to the Roots
Return to the Roots is an open source fan remake of The Settlers II. With a completely rewritten game engine 'RttR' aims to support modern hardware and operating systems and extend the original The Settlers II with features such as a multiplayer mode via internet. You will need an original "The Settlers 2 Gold Edition" version to play as Return To The Roots uses the original sounds and graphics.
